I am in need of some assistance. I am new to both Alpha 5 and the basic language. I�ve searched the forum, but didn�t find anything that helped. By the way, everything I am doing in A5 is with the genies. First, I will describe what I am attempting to do and then I�ll describe the issue. I have two A5 tables. I need a subset of records from the Primary table and a subset of records from the transaction table. I need to keep only those records where the primary key exists in both the primary table subset and the transaction table subset. In other words, I need the intersection of the two subsets. The first thing I did was create two Copy Operations to extract the needed records from each table. Then I created a Set with the two new tables. In the link definition, I selected to include records from the primary table only if a matching child record DOES exist. This worked great and I created a browse and report from this set of records. Now the process needs to be menu driven for end users. It is the automation process that has caused my road block. On the code tab using action scripting, I set up actions to run the �copy� operations and open the browse. Running the code generates a message, which says, �The current table cannot be overwritten.� However, running the copy operations manually from the operations tab, the tables are overwritten. Why the difference? I have added zapping and packing actions prior to the copy operation but that did not make a difference. I tried using only one copy operation, where I created a subset of Primary table with a copy operation and linking that to the �transaction� table. I also tired inserting a table.close() command into the script that was created by the genie and couldn�t get that to work at all. I am sure there is a piece of the puzzle that is missing. But I am at a loss as to why the copy operation will not work when called via action scripting. Any assistance is appreciated. Thanks, Sherry.
